Mama Jack's Preparatory Academy in Jonesboro, GA offers early childhood education with programs for preschool (PK) and kindergarten students in a suburban community setting.
The school enrolls 29 students total, with 19 students in K–12 grades and a student–teacher ratio of 10:1 supported by 3 teachers.
Mama Jack's Preparatory Academy is nonsectarian and provides a co–educational learning environment with 100% student representation of students of color.
The academy ranks among the top 20% of private schools in Georgia for diversity, based on student demographics.
